This is from an article originally called, "Next Generation Search Engines"
"By analyzing a web's links, search engines can determine with greater reliability if a web site is actually related to the search inquiry. This analysis is basically done in two steps. First, the search engine does a traditional search for web pages containing the query word or phrase. Then the search engine counts the number of links to and from other web pages containing the same word or phrase. The higher the number, the higher the "confidence level" that the page or site fits the search request." ____________________________________ Here's what's funny about the above quote: It was published on June 10, 1999 in Realty Times, seven years ago, at a time when most agents were very stingy about outward bound links from their sites. It is different world now. The point? Don't just figure out what works now or what used to work. Think about what will work in the future.
